Quality Assurance Analyst
Job Details
job summary:
location: Charlotte, North Carolina
job type: Contract
salary: $50 - 60 per hour
work hours: 9am to 5pm
education: Bachelors

Job Description:
- Develops detailed, comprehensive and well-structured test cases based on functional requirements
- Contributes to test planning, and when part of a Scrum team, builds test cases for stories in the given sprint as per story acceptance criteria
- Automates the test cases in User-Interface(UI) and database using tools like Selenium/Tosca
- Builds and uses test data required to accomplish execution of test cases
- Executes test cases, including manual and automated tests, and records test results
- Test new and existing features, debug code (units and integration) and report errors and failures
- Work collaboratively with the development team for defect triaging
- Execute all levels of testing (Functional, Integration, and Regression)
- Design, develop, execute automation scripts
- Ownership in end-end testing
- Detect and track software defects and inconsistencies; provide timely solutions
- Apply quality principles throughout the Agile product lifecycle with the appropriate support and documentation
- Ensure that all the standards and process are being implemented within a projects
